Book range figures assume long range cruise, standard reserves and a stated payload. Load the cabin, add bags, put the departure field at elevation on a hot afternoon, and the real number comes down. We treat anything above roughly 80 percent of book range as a leg that needs the operator to confirm against the specific tail number rather than the brochure.

Cost
What moves the number
The honest answer to what this costs is that it depends, so here is precisely what it depends on.
- Positioning. Where the aircraft sits when you call. If it is already on your departure ramp you pay for your legs only. If it has to fly in empty and fly home afterwards, someone pays for that, and it is you.
- Daily minimum. Most operators bill a minimum number of flight hours per day the aircraft is away. A short leg with a three night stay can price higher than a long leg that returns the same day.
- Crew duty. A crew has a legal duty limit. Cross enough time zones or depart late enough and the trip needs a second crew or an overnight, and both cost money.
- Ramp and handling. Landing fees, ramp fees, overnight parking and the FBO handling charge vary enormously between fields in the same metro.
- Peak days. Operators apply surcharges around the predictable weekends. Thanksgiving Sunday, the Super Bowl, Art Basel, the Fourth of July and the ski season change of week all price differently.
- De-icing. Winter departures from northern fields add de-icing, which is charged by volume of fluid and can be a serious number on a large aircraft.
- Federal excise tax. Domestic United States charter carries a federal excise tax plus segment fees. It is a real line and it belongs in any quote you are comparing.

Are empty legs available on this route?
Sometimes. An empty leg exists when an operator has to reposition an aircraft along this track anyway, so the timing is theirs and not yours. They appear and vanish with little notice and get cancelled when the paying trip behind them changes.
